#42092c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#42092c is composed of 25.9% red, 3.5%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.4%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 323.2 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 14.7%. #42092c color hex could be obtained by blending #841258 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#42092c color description : Very d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#42092c has RGB values of R:66, G:9,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.33,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 4327724.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0209 is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#282326 is the less saturated color, while #4b002e is the most saturated one.
